# Heads up, support folks: this client talks to Glyphsniff, our
# encoding-detection service for uploaded text files. When a customer
# says their upload looks like garbage characters, Glyphsniff's verdict
# (charset + confidence) is the first thing to check before blaming
# the file itself. The client below needs an API key to call the
# internal endpoint, and here it is.

gateway credential: kto23_LX9A4ys6i4nzHtpOLNLodKK

## Deployment

Validator plugins for Quillgate load at startup from the plugins directory; no hot reload. Ship each plugin as a signed bundle, bump the manifest version, and restart the quillgate-core service. Rollback: restore the previous bundle and restart. Do not mix plugin API versions in one release — the loader rejects the whole set. Verify with the smoke suite before tagging. The loader reads the following configuration values at boot:

settings of kagup-tagug:
ULAIX_HOST=ulaix.zemvarsys.internal
ULAIX_PORT=8000

## Runbook: encoding detection, Parchment uploader

For release cut: verify the detection service passes the fixture suite (UTF-8, UTF-16, Shift-variant samples) before tagging. Misdetections surface as garbled previews in the Quill dashboard. If detection confidence drops below threshold in canary, hold the release and roll back the classifier model. Canary runs with the production configuration shown here.

config for tajof-kawep:
[aldius]
port = 3000
region = lower-2
host = aldius.plorvasoft.example
team = eliius
timeout_ms = 750
retries = 6